Max Verstappen, the winner of the Grand Prix of the Netherlands, repeated Sebastian Vettel’s record

With his ninth consecutive victory, Verstappen equaled Sebastian Vettel’s record from 2013 and can surpass it at the next stage.

The Dutchman covered 72 laps in 2:24:04, and the podium was completed by Fernando Alonso (Aston Martin) and Gasly Pierre (Alpine).

Verstappen’s Red Bull teammate Sergio Perez finished fourth, followed by Carlos Sainz Jr. (Ferrari).

As in qualifying, Logan Sargeant (Williams) and Charles Leclerc (Ferrari) crashed on laps 15 and 41 respectively and were unable to continue the race.

Zhou Guanyu (Alfa Romeo) was also injured on lap 62 after it started to rain, the organizers activated the red flag and the race was interrupted due to weather conditions and restarted after the weather stabilized.
